There will be no dearth of money to shield people from inflation: Gehlot

Sri Ganganagar: CM Ashok Gehlot while addressing the beneficiaries at the ‘Inflation Relief Camp’ at Ganeshgarh in Sriganganagar on Thursday, promised that there would be no shortage of resources to run the public welfare schemes and protect the common man against inflation.

“Along with this, free treatment of Rs 25 lakh in Chief Minister Chiranjeevi Health Insurance Scheme for Nirogi Rajasthan, accident insurance of Rs 10 lakh, additional employment for 25 days under the CM’s Rural Employment Guarantee Scheme and additional employment for 100 days for Kathodi, Sahariya and specially- abled people, along with 125 days of employment under the Indira Gandhi Urban Employment Guarantee Scheme, the common man will get strength. Under the Chief Minister’s Free Annapurna Food Packet Scheme, the beneficiaries who come under the ambit of national food security will get free Annapurna food packets every month. The registration of all eligible persons at the relief camps would continue,” he said. The CM also interacted with the beneficiaries.

PCC Chief Govind Singh Dotasra said that about 92 percent budget announcements have been completed by the state government. “Rajasthan is leading in providing relief to the common man,” he said.
